The differance in that there was a clear, pre-existing rule in baseball that any betting on the game would lead to to a lifetime ban. Steroids were not banned by the MLB so technically they cannot deny Bonds admission to the HOF on that basis. Yes they were illegal in the United States as a controlled substance. If you're going to start denying admission to the HOF based on crimes which have been comitted or on the basis of having/using a controlled substance there are a number of guys who should be taken out. Of course steroids are a different matter because they enchance performance, but if you look at Barry's numbers before he started using they're clearly HOF worthy. I just dont think there's a solid basis here for denying him admission to the hall.

Originally posted by joeboo- There was an excerpt from the book where they talked about how Bonds came to the park one day during the Mac/Sosa HR chase. They roped off the batting cage area when McGwire was hitting because the media circus was nuts (you'll know exactly what I mean if you ever saw Mac hit BP during that time).
Anyhow, Bonds asked what it was all about. They told him and he replied "Not in my house" and then stormed over to the ropes and tore them down.
